Disabling Procedure

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2004 Pontiac Grand Prix.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
IMPORTANT: Refer to SIR Service Precautions .
  1. Turn the steering wheel so that the vehicle's wheels are pointing straight ahead.
  2. Turn the ignition switch to the OFF position.
  3. Remove the key from the ignition switch.
  4. Open the hood and locate the underhood fuse center on right/passenger shock tower.
  5. Fig 1: Locating SIR Fuse
    GM465618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
    IMPORTANT: With the SIR Fuse removed and the ignition ON, the AIR BAG indicator illuminates. This is normal operation, and does not indicate an SIR system malfunction.
  6. Lift the cover for the underhood fuse center.
  7. Locate and remove the SIR fuse from the underhood fuse center.
  8. When disabling the right/passenger seat belt pretensioner perform step 8, if Sensing and Diagnostic Module (SDM) needs disabling then use entire procedure.
  9. Fig 2: View Of Deployment Harness At Side Impact Module
    GM628320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  10. Remove the connector position assurance (CPA) from the left/driver seat belt pretensioner connector (1) located under the driver seat.
  11. Disconnect the seat belt pretensioner-left connector from vehicle wiring harness connector (1).
  12. Fig 3: Locating Sunroof Components
    GM902186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  13. Remove the right rear sail panel. Refer to Sail Panel Replacement in Interior Trim.
  14. Remove the CPA from the right/passenger roof rail module connector (2).
  15. Disconnect the right roof rail module wiring harness yellow connector (2) from the right roof rail module (3).
  16. Fig 4: Identifying I/P Module Connector To Vehicle Harness Connector
    GM816857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  17. Remove the right/passenger sound insulator from the instrument panel (I/P) (3). Refer to Closeout/Insulator Panel Replacement - Right in Instrument Panel, Gages and Console.
  18. Remove the CPA from the I/P module yellow connector (1).
  19. Disconnect the I/P module yellow connector (1) from the vehicle harness yellow connector (2).
  20. Fig 5: Identifying I/P Module Connector To Vehicle Harness Connector (LH Side I/P)
    GM812533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  21. Remove the left/driver sound insulator from the instrument panel (I/P) (2). Refer to Closeout/Insulator Panel Replacement - Left in Instrument Panel, Gages and Console.
  22. Remove the CPA from the steering wheel module coil yellow connector (1).
  23. Disconnect the steering wheel module coil yellow connector (1) from the vehicle harness yellow connector (3).
  24. Fig 6: View Of Deployment Harness At Side Impact Module
    GM628320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  25. Remove the CPA from the left/driver seat belt pretensioner connector (1) located under the driver seat.
  26. Disconnect the seat belt pretensioner-left connector from vehicle wiring harness connector (1).
  27. Fig 7: Locating Sunroof Components
    GM902186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  28. Remove the left rear sail panel. Refer to Sail Panel Replacement in Interior Trim.
  29. Remove the CPA from the left/driver roof rail module connector (2).
  30. Disconnect the left roof rail module wiring harness yellow connector (2) from the left roof rail module (3).
